The Kirkpatrick model of evaluation, developed by Donald Kirkpatrick in the 1950s, is a widely recognized framework for assessing training programs. It consists of four levels of evaluation: Level 1 (Reaction), Level 2 (Learning), Level 3 (Behavior), and Level 4 (Results). As one progresses through these levels, the evaluations become more challenging to conduct but yield greater insights into the effectiveness of training. This model serves as a foundational tool for those aspiring to become instructional designers or those seeking to evaluate training initiatives. It is recommended as a starting point for understanding and implementing effective training evaluation strategies.
